STUETZLE, Walther

STUETZLE, Walther. German, b. 1941. Genres: International relations/ Current affairs. Career: Friedrich-Neumann Foundation, staff member, 1967- 68; Theodor Heuss Akademie, Gummersbach, Germany, lecturer, 1967-68; International Institute for Strategic Studies, London, England, research associate, 1968; German Society for Foreign Affairs, Bonn, Germany, researcher at Research Institute, 1969; German Ministry for Defense, founding member of planning staff, 1969-71, secretary to Independent Armed Forces Structure Commission, 1971-72, private secretary to the minister of defense, 1973-76, head of planning staff, 1976-82, promoted to under- secretary for defense, planning, and policy, 1982; Stuttgarter Zeitung, Stuttgart, Germany, international security and defense correspondent, 1983; Stockholm International Peace Research Institute, Sweden, director, 1986-91; Der Tagesspiegel, Berlin, editor-in-chief, 1992-98; deputy secretary of defense, Berlin, 1998-2002. Guest on national and international television and radio programs; moderator of a monthly talk show on German television, 1992-97. Publications: Adenauer und Kennedy in der Berlin Krise, 1961-1962, 1973; Politik and Kraefteverhaeltnis, 1983; (with A. Buchan and C.B.C. Gasteyger) Europe's Future, Europe's Choices (bilingual in English and German), 1967; (ed.) SIPRI Yearbook World Armament and Disarmament, 1986-91; The ABM Treaty: To Defend or Not to Defend? 1987; (with Weidenfeld, Gasteyger, and J. Janning) Die Architektur europaeischer Sicherheit: Probleme, Kriterien, Perspektiven, 1989; (ed. with A. Rotfeld) Germany and Europe in Transition, 1991; (with W. Wiedenfeld) Abschied von der alten Ordnung: Europas neue Sicherheit, 1993. Contributor to periodicals. Address: Traunsteiner Str 2/IV, D-10781 Berlin, Germany.
